Suggested Books on Brazilian Music and Culture

Bookmark and Share
Caetano Veloso. Tropical Truth: A Story of Music and Revolution in Brazil. New York: Knopf, 2002.

Christopher Dunn. Brutality Garden: Tropicália and the Emergence of a Brazilian Counterculture. Chapel Hill: University of North Carolina Press, 2001.

Charles Perrone. Masters of Contemporary Brazilian Song. Austin: University of Texas Press, 1989.

Charles Perrone and Christopher Dunn. Brazilian Popular Music and Globalization. New York: Routledge, 2001.

Chris McGowen and Ricardo Pessanha. The Brazilian Sound: Samba, Bossa Nova, and the Popular Music of Brazil. 2nd ed. Philadelphia: Temple University Press, 1998.

Joseph Page. The Brazilians. New York: Addison-Wesley, 1995.
